Sci -fi lovers are familiar with worms as a means not only for time travel, but also for bridging the gaps between two distant places. In the TV series Star Trek: Deep Space 9 , the spacecraft of the wormhole walk through to achieve the distant corners of other universes. The wormholes can be better understood when one visualizes a piece of paper with a hole perforated at both ends. The distance between the holes is reduced by bending the paper and by placing the holes on one another. A small space between the two holes is a worm hole.
